WebYou can start Social Security any time between age 62 and age 70. Your FERS supplement payment will stop at age 62 regardless of when you choose to turn on Social Security. … WebThe FERS Supplement is also called the Special Retirement Supplement or SRS. It is designed to help bridge the money gap for certain FERS who retire before age 62. It will …
